Why Participate?

​Your participation will directly support our inclusive sports, health, schools and leadership programs for children and adults with intellectual disabilities.

Through Special Olympics, our athletes build friendships, overcome obstacles and are empowered to realize their full potential. Success on the field leads to more opportunities in daily life as the community learns about the unique abilities and contributions of our athletes. All Special Olympics programs are provided at no cost to the athletes and their families thanks to your support.
